First, understand what's included. A truly affordable eye exam isn't just the lowest price tag; it's a good value. A comprehensive exam should check for vision clarity, eye health, and signs of systemic conditions like diabetes or high blood pressure, which are important for our overall well-being. When calling local clinics or those in nearby hubs like Hays or Great Bend, ask specifically what the exam fee covers. Does it include a retinal health check? Is a dilation part of the standard cost? Knowing this helps you compare true value.
Next, explore all your options for savings. Many residents in Catharine may be eligible for programs they aren't aware of. If you have children, check if their school or a local organization partners with vision care programs. For seniors on Medicare, ask clinics if they accept Medicare assignment for annual diabetic eye exams or exams for medical conditions. Don't forget about vision insurance plans, even standalone ones, which can significantly reduce out-of-pocket costs for a routine exam. If you're paying out-of-pocket, some clinics offer a cash-pay discount or a packaged price for an exam and basic glasses.
